Puerto Rican jibaro: yellow rice sautéed with sofrito and annatto oil and topped with a fried egg. Uzbek plov: a descendant of a dish said to have been served to Alexander the Great in the city now called Samarkand, with his army importing the preparation to Macedonia and Greece. Rice has been a documented food source since 2500 BC, and has been cultivated since 2000 BC, beginning in China along the Huai and Yangtze rivers, then spreading to Sri Lanka and India, before the rest of the world caught up, with Europe introduced to rice thanks to its role as an early staple in Greece, and the Americas following suit when Portuguese colonists imported it to Brazil. New Orleans red beans and rice: many of the world’s cultures combine these two inexpensive, filling starches, but it is a gourmet treat in New Orleans, with andouille sausage, pepper, onion and smoky spices. Milanese risotto: the classic of northern Italian cuisine (here's the iconic recipe by Italian chef Gualtiero Marchesi) features Arborio rice slowly cooked with wine and broth, until it achieves an ideal brothy-bite.
